A leading seafood processing company in the UK is looking for a Supply Base Executive to manage supplier compliance and ensure a transparent supply chain.
Responsibilities include:
- Supporting third-party audits
- Maintaining supplier management systems
- Ensuring all documentation meets required standards
Ideal candidates have experience in fast-paced food manufacturing and strong interpersonal skills. The role offers a collaborative environment with a focus on regulatory and ethical compliance.
